INTRODUCE YOUR CHILD TO NURSERY SCHOOL WITH MID-YEAR 2-YEAR-OLD PROGRAM AT THE YJCC
Do you have a child who will turn two by April 30, 2015 and is ready for a nursery school experience? The Bergen County YJCC’s David Rukin Early Childhood Center Nursery School’s “Mid-Year 2s” is a perfect opportunity to introduce your young child to early childhood education, complete with the rich array of educational and social experiences the YJCC program provides. Registration for mid-year 2s is ongoing, with classes beginning in January.
Registration for 2-, 3-, and 4-year-olds for the 2015-16 school year will begin in January. The YJCC Nursery School promotes individual growth, development and creative expression through a variety of experiences and activities. Its innovative curriculum includes reading, math and handwriting readiness within a developmentally appropriate environment. A creative approach to Judaic customs and holidays is an integral element of the curriculum, emphasizing Jewish values and culture. The YJCC has a custom-designed playground, and children use the gymnasium and indoor swimming pools under the supervision of YJCC physical education and aquatics staff. Along with half- and extended-day programs, the YJCC offers a full-day option. 
Tours may be scheduled now for families considering the Mid-Year 2s program, as well as for those considering Nursery School next fall. YJCC membership is required to enable enrollment in the Nursery School.
